Naturally curly, my hair is cut into a pixie cut, which I blow dry and straighten with two This dryer seemed like it would be the perfect choice for taming frizz and straightening my short hair, after reading the reviews. A lot of people have said that the dryer is cute, lightweight, and easy to use. Compared to my other blow dryer, it took twice as long to blow dry my hair and it did not straighten my roots as much. In order for me to blow out my roots well, I use two different round brushes of different sizes. Because I have no problems with my other dryer, I am assuming that this blow dryer does not get hot enough. After drying my hair for 15 minutes, I noticed that my hair began curling up. Despite not having as much frizz as usual, I had to blow dry it a few more times to get it straightened (and use my mini flat iron to help get the roots straight).
